Song Meaning
This track paints a picture of absolute, all-consuming devotion. The narrator's waking hours and sleeping moments are entirely consumed by thoughts of a singular person. It's a world where every second, regardless of the season or the weather, is dedicated to this singular focus. The sheer repetition of 'dream of you' hammers home the inescapable nature of this fixation.
The central tension lies in the narrator's complete surrender to this dream state. There's a sense of longing, but it's framed not as a struggle, but as the only state of being. The lyrics suggest a desire for even more time, not for varied experiences, but to intensify this singular, dreamlike existence. The narrator isn't just thinking about the person; they *are* the thought, the song, the entirety of existence.
The most striking aspect is the cyclical, almost relentless structure. The verses loop back to the core idea, emphasizing the 24/7 nature of the obsession. The inclusion of all seasons and times of day – 'Summer, winter, autumn, and spring,' 'Morning, noon, and night-time' – serves to highlight that no temporal or environmental factor can break this spell. It's a powerful depiction of how one person can become the entire universe for another.
Ultimately, the effectiveness comes from its unyielding simplicity and directness. The constant return to 'dream of you' creates a hypnotic effect, mirroring the narrator's own mental state. It's a pure distillation of infatuation, where the world outside the dream fades into irrelevance, leaving only the vivid, persistent image of the beloved.
